When Will SpaceX Go Public in 2026?
SpaceX is expected to go public in June 2026 if the current reported IPO timeline moves forward as planned. Sources indicate the company may first complete a confidential filing in April before moving into regulatory review, investor roadshows, pricing, and final listing. This means June would be the likely public listing month rather than the filing date itself, and an April filing would strongly support a mid-2026 IPO.
Has SpaceX Started Its IPO Filing?
SpaceX has not officially confirmed that IPO filing has started, but reports suggest the company may confidentially file its prospectus during April 2026. This would be the first formal step toward becoming a publicly traded company and would show real progress beyond market rumors. For investors, confidential filing is often the clearest sign that an IPO is becoming serious.
Why Is the June 2026 IPO Date Important?
The June 2026 IPO date is important as it could mark one of the largest public listings in market history for SpaceX. Reports suggest the company may raise more than $75 billion, with valuation expectations reaching around $1.75 trillion, far exceeding many recent major IPOs. A successful June listing would not only bring SpaceX into the public market but also set a powerful valuation benchmark for the entire commercial aerospace sector, influencing investor confidence across space-related stocks.
Could the SpaceX IPO Timeline Change?
Yes, the SpaceX IPO timeline could still change even if confidential filing begins in April 2026. Regulatory review, market conditions, company strategy, and financial decisions can all delay or accelerate the listing schedule. Until SpaceX officially confirms the final listing date, June 2026 should be viewed as the strongest expectation rather than a guaranteed deadline.
